About The Position

Protective is seeking an analytical accounting professional to join our Financial Reporting team in our Birmingham, AL office. This role supports the preparation and analysis of financial results across our life insurance and annuity businesses, including the Protection, Retirement, and Acquisitions segments. The ideal candidate will bring a strong foundation in accounting and financial analysis, along with a collaborative mindset and attention to detail. This position offers the opportunity to partner cross-functionally with accounting, FP&A, and actuarial teams, contributing to accurate and timely financial reporting while supporting ongoing process improvements. This is a Hybrid role which reports to the office 3 times a week.

Responsibilities

  • Perform analysis of traditional life product performance, including review of trends and variance drivers
  • Prepare segment-level reporting packages and disclosures for the Acquisitions segment
  • Partner with accounting, FP&A, and actuarial teams to understand and communicate financial results
  • Serve as a primary contact for assigned products or acquisition transactions, including accounting analysis and journal entries
  • Support quarterly close processes through income statement and balance sheet analytics and explanations
  • Ensure assigned controls are performed and operating effectively in support of accurate financial reporting
  • Coordinate with internal teams to improve processes impacting financial reporting and analysis
  • Support internal and external audit requests and respond to accounting-related inquiries
  • Contribute to process improvement initiatives, including reducing manual processes
